BUT, if you need to stay connected to the outside, the WIFI isn't reliable enough. I only bring this up for those that think it will be strong. I just never found it that way. I was hoping to work a bit, but no way. I tried Slack chats and Zoom, neither worked well enough to use. I saw it only once as high as 3 mbps, but usually averaged 240-404 kbps. We only use wifi calling at home, but it wouldn't work there much. Big lag. Text with photos took hours to send. Tried to pull stuff down from the Dish on demand, only got two shows down during the whole week. But, if you don't need to be connected for anything major, it is there, just not consistent.
